Care and Maintenance of Brown Recliner Leather Sofas
To prolong the life of a brown recliner leather sofa, employing regular maintenance practices is necessary. Here are some essential tips:
- Cleaning: Wipe down the leather regularly with a soft, damp cloth to remove dust and debris. Use a leather-specific cleaner occasionally.
- Conditioning: Apply a leather conditioner every six months to maintain suppleness and prevent cracking.
- Avoid Direct Sunlight: Position the sofa away from direct sunlight to prevent fading and heat damage.
FAQs About Brown Recliner Leather Sofas
Q: Are brown recliner leather sofas suitable for homes with pets?
A: Yes, but it’s vital to take precautions. While leather is durable, pet claws can scratch it. Use protective throws or pet-specific furniture covers to mitigate potential damage.
Q: How do I know if a leather sofa is genuine?
A: Genuine leather often has a distinct texture and feel. When in doubt, check for labels that denote "top grain" or "full grain" as indicators of quality.
Q: Can I adjust the reclining angle?
A: Most modern recliner sofas feature adjustable reclining positions, allowing you to find the perfect angle for comfort.
Q: How often should I clean my leather sofa?
A: A quick weekly dusting is ideal, with deep cleaning occurring every few months or as needed.
Q: What is the average lifespan of a leather sofa?
A: With proper care, a high-quality leather sofa can last 15 years or longer.
